VERY IMPORTANT AFTER SURGERY:

-   First check if you feel your legs
-   Check if you feel your legs equally
-   Check if you feel cold-warm difference on your legs
-   Check if your legs moves equally under your commends
-   Check for infection signs
-   Very critics are next 48 hours when can happen embolia (blood clot or fat clot)
-   In the first 2 weeks be carefully to not cut yourself, any kind of cut, because the bleeding is hard to be stopped
-   When you learn to use the wheelchair, be carefully at the start, because on too fast startup or putting too much force in starting forward you can rotate backward  (you know that effect in motorcycling)… and that could be bad for you and your nails !
-   Never try to put the whole body weight on your Precice nails !... If they bend or the fine mechanism breaks down, will be a drama !
-   You should train your fists before surgery, because most of the body moving from wheelchair to bed, you should do it on your fists, because you gain 2-3 inches (5-8 cm)
-   If you feel and think that there is something dangerous for you, just react. Otherwise you will regret later
-   Always you have to park the wheelchair in the perfect position and angle, so that will avoid accidents in transferring your body
-   Always put the both brakes on wheelchair !.... If you don’t do that, your wheelchair will rotate and you can have an accident
-   Don’t come fat at the surgery, because not all are losing weight. Some people didn’t lose anything for the whole period and that is a permanent risk for your nails, for your transfer from/to wheelchair and for your recover. The best candidates are skinny persons.

Standing up on Precice is allowed only in the first 5 days after the FIRST surgery, when the nails are strongest (because they wasn't elongated yet) but after that it is completely forbidden to stand-up.
And I didn't, especially because of my femur sensitive nails.
That advice to do it no matter what is for Ilizarov, LON, Betzbone/Gnail and Stride/Max.

And, yes, because of that, the callus formation could start later than others, especially on tibias. That happened to me.

So, totally I will stay in wheelchair 6-7 months, 4 and a half here and 2-3 months home, till the strong  callus formation.
The guys with 12mm nails diameters are more lucky, they can stand up a month earlier, due to the strengthen of nails.

Ok, I repeat here for you:

I started on femur with 0.35mm/session x 3 times/day. That means 1.05mm/day.
After tibia implant, I started on tibia same, with 0.35mm/session x 3 times/day. That means 2.1mm/day, for femur + tibia.
When I felt too much pain from elongation, I slowed down to 0.35mm/session x 2 times/day, to all 4 segments. That means 1.4mm/day, for femur + tibia, till the end.

For those who don't know, the 2 screws are only for short time, to keep your ankle stable during lengthening, but once callus is started you don't need them because it stays against your ankle mobility. And this is right, because whenever I force my ankle tendon I feel pain in that spot, where the screws are.
